Popcorn has been a staple of the movie theater experience since the early 1900s. It is the quintessential snack to enjoy while watching a movie in a dark theater, and its popularity is still going strong. But what popcorn is closest to that of a movie theater?

The key to finding out which popcorn is closest to the theater experience lies in understanding what makes movie theater popcorn so special. Movie theaters use large, stainless steel poppers that are more powerful than home versions.

These poppers use large quantities of coconut oil, which gives the popcorn its signature flavor and texture. This combination of oil and heat creates fluffy, crunchy kernels that are irresistible to moviegoers everywhere.

The best way for home cooks to replicate this unique flavor and texture is to purchase a quality air popper or stovetop kettle popper, such as the Whirley Pop or Theatre Pop, which can be found online or in specialty kitchen stores. These poppers are designed specifically for popping large amounts of popcorn and allow you to add your own choice of oil and seasonings for a more personalized snack.

Once you’ve found your preferred popper, it’s time to find the right kernels. Look for high-quality kernels that are labeled “movie theater style” as they’re specifically designed for air poppers or stovetop kettles. These kernels will pop up larger and fluffier than regular popping corn, creating an authentic movie theater taste without relying on copious amounts of coconut oil or other unhealthy fats.

Lastly, don’t forget about seasoning! While it may be tempting to load up on buttery toppings like melted cheese or caramel sauce, these ingredients can quickly overpower the delicate flavors of freshly popped corn. Instead opt for classic seasonings such as salt, pepper, garlic powder or even sugar for a more subtle flavor profile that won’t overpower your perfect batch of popcorn.

In conclusion, achieving the perfect batch of movie-theater-style popcorn at home requires three key elements: quality equipment, high-quality kernels and subtle seasonings.
